Congress leader joins chorus against DMK candidate
Tirunelveli (TN), Apr 19: Joining the chorus by local DMK workers against the candidature of former minister T P Mohideen Khan frm Palayamkottai assembly constituency here, a Congress functionary on Monday said a strong candidate should be fielded by the Dravidian party.
The agitations against the DMK candidate would only create confusion among the voters and hence the DMK high command should put an end to it by changing the candidate, Tirunelveli Urban Congress Committee President K Ramanath told reporters here.

He said he was confident that the DMK-Congress front will win in all the ten constituencies in the district provided the "weak" candidate fielded in Palayamkottai was replaced with a strong candidate.
